Output ede32f6564219a78d14f42b99689291cb98f57d3405c9db66c2c189a6ba5fb4b: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52cffab4e8b290a020465308df2474e287119a86 OP_EQUAL
address
39EtUvvbwwEXCBnvD2292Q9ZrHy7jka5iL
transaction
ede32f6564219a78d14f42b99689291cb98f57d3405c9db66c2c189a6ba5fb4b
spent
true